This project is a physical simulation that will provide possible solutions to a specific design.

“Whether it be the sweeping eagle in his flight, or the open apple-blossom, the toiling work-horse, the blithe swan, the branching oak, the winding stream at its base, the drifting clouds, over all the coursing sun, form ever follows function, and this is the law. Where function does not change, form does not change. The granite rocks, the ever-brooding hills, remain for ages; the lightning lives, comes into shape, and dies, in a twinkling. It is the pervading law of all things organic and inorganic, of all things physical and metaphysical, of all things human and all things superhuman, of all true manifestations of the head, of the heart, of the soul, that the life is recognizable in its expression, that form ever follows function. This is the law”


1896, Louis Sullivan

Shape follows functionality is the law. In order to achieve that I find myself many times iterating through different possibilities. The first one usually based on some the information I have but it is mainly a calculated guess. I try one approach then another, one idea to solve a problem then another. This is always a very long process. This project is about taking this so called guess basing it on a better platform. With an computed process of simplified evolution process in which the better versions of the design (which are the iterations that came closer to the goal that was set) are the ones that will continue and “live” while the less appropriate designs, the ones that are far from the goal, simply cease to exist. With some degree of mutation (to achieve new designs) I want to obtain a system that will give as a start a reference to follow and later maybe a model to imitate.

The idea came when I was sketching a “Sun armor” made of solar panels that require a shape that will allow as much sun arriving in a perpendicular manner. I realize that I could define the goal mathematically and define the main environmental influences to allow a system that will evolve and create a design that might be surprising.

zimounThe thought of computed design might be difficult for us, especially as the concept of “design” is associated with beauty. But as Louis Sullivan wrote “form follow function” that is the law, and so we can take advantage of the computer capabilities to create a tool that can iterate much faster and much accurate then we could ever iterate to achieve a direction that then can be manipulated and change by man. Karl Sims in his “Artificial life in computer animation” showed how creatures made of rectangles can evolve and change through this computed evolution process, that might have little to do with the physical world, but surely created unexpected behaviors.


In this sketch I am using Saito OBJ loader library and Peasycam to control the camera view.

The Sun armor itself is a separate project which looks to humanize energy using a physical armor in a street performance. For more about this projects follow this link.


